Can Cinnamon Rolls in Air Fryer? – Method

An air fryer is a small appliance that uses hot air to cook and crisp up food, similar to a deep fryer but without the added oil.

So, can you make cinnamon rolls in an air fryer? The short answer is yes, but it does require some adjustments to the recipe and technique. Here is a complete method to make cinnamon rolls in an air fryer:

1. Choosing the Right Cinnamon Roll Recipe

Not all cinnamon roll recipes are created equal, and some may work better in an air fryer than others. It’s important to choose a recipe that uses a dough that will rise and bake well in the air fryer.

A good rule of thumb is to use a recipe that calls for yeast, as the yeast will help the dough rise and give the cinnamon rolls a light and fluffy texture.

Avoid recipes that use baking powder or baking soda, as these will not work as well in an air fryer.

It’s also a good idea to choose a recipe that uses a filling of cinnamon and sugar, rather than one with a lot of additional ingredients like nuts or raisins.

These extra ingredients may not cook evenly in the air fryer and could result in uneven or undercooked cinnamon rolls.

2. Preparing the Dough

Once you have chosen a suitable cinnamon roll recipe, the next step is to prepare the dough. Follow the recipe instructions for mixing and kneading the dough, and let it rise until it has doubled in size.

This may take longer in an air fryer than in an oven, so be patient and allow enough time for the dough to rise fully.

Once the dough has risen, roll it out into a large rectangle on a lightly floured surface. Spread the filling of cinnamon and sugar over the dough, leaving a small border around the edges. Roll the dough into a tight log, and slice it into individual cinnamon rolls using a sharp knife.

3. Air Frying the Cinnamon Rolls

Now it’s time to air fry the cinnamon rolls. Preheat your air fryer to 350°F, and lightly coat the basket with cooking spray.

Place the cinnamon rolls in the basket, making sure to leave enough space between them for the hot air to circulate. You may need to cook the cinnamon rolls in batches depending on the size of your air fryer.

Cook the cinnamon rolls for about 10-12 minutes, or until they are golden brown and cooked through.

The cooking time will depend on the size of your cinnamon rolls and the wattage of your air fryer, so be sure to check on them frequently and adjust the cooking time as needed.

4. Making the Icing

While the cinnamon rolls are cooking, it’s a good idea to prepare the icing. Most cinnamon roll recipes include a simple icing made with powdered sugar, milk, and vanilla extract. Whisk these ingredients together until smooth, and set aside until the cinnamon rolls are ready.

5. Finishing and Serving the Cinnamon Rolls

Once the cinnamon rolls are cooked and cooled slightly, it’s time to finish and serve them.

Spread the icing over the top of the cinnamon rolls, and garnish with additional cinnamon if desired. Serve the cinnamon rolls warm, and enjoy!
